## Onboarding: Crumbline Order Cutoff

Release managers should know that the Crumbline bakery platform enforces a hard 2 p.m. order cutoff; deploys after that window must not touch the scheduling service. The cutoff config lives in a sealed store and changes require dual sign-off. To open the sealed store, enter the recovery passphrase below.

vault phrase of tajop-haduf = holath-brivan-wenax

Handover note — Crumbwheel order cutoffs.

Welcome aboard. The bakery cutoff rule in Crumbwheel closes same-day orders at 14:00 local to each storefront, not UTC — this has bitten us twice. Holiday overrides live in the calendar service and take precedence silently, so always check there first when a cutoff looks wrong. To unlock the calendar service's admin console after a restart, enter the recovery passphrase below.

vault phrase of bagap-bahaf = silion-pelox-sorox-casdor-quenwyn-fraax-eliox-praael-kelion-quenvan-kasox-rusael-norius-belvan

Quick reminder for anyone booking candidate interviews at the Marwick Lane office: the secure interview room on level 2 is the only space cleared for external visitors without an escort. Please book it through the Roomlet calendar at least a day ahead, and make sure your candidate signs in downstairs first. Keep the door closed during sessions — it auto-locks, so don't prop it open with a chair like last time. To unlock it from the outside, use the pass code below.

badge for haduf-bafop: bdg-O-78

The Larkspool user module will be extracted from the monolith behind an internal gRPC boundary, with session validation duplicated on both sides during the transition. All cross-service calls carry short-lived signed tokens; clock skew and token lifetime interact directly with replay risk. The security-relevant timing and rate constants governing this transition window are pinned as follows.

constants for bagag-fawip:
BUDGETS = {
    "wenius": 400,
    "brieth": 224,
    "rusath": 783,
    "eliys": 187,
    "aldax": 737,
    "ralion": 818,
    "istius": 153,
}